Looking after Your Verdant Green Marble Areas
To preserve the elegance of your Ming Green marble finishes , regular cleaning is key . Avoid abrasive chemicals , as they can etch the surface . We recommend frequent dusting with a soft cloth. For stains , wipe immediately with a damp cloth and a mild cleanser . Explore using a marble protectant periodically to improve the shine and offer additional defense against damage.
- Clean with a soft cloth often.
- Steer clear of harsh chemicals .
- Blot liquids immediately .
- Put on a marble polish occasionally .
